Miss India Worldwide 1999 was the 9th edition of the international female pageant. The final was held in Rahway, New Jersey United States on November 27, 1999. About 22 countries were represented in the pageant. Aarti Chabaria [1] of India crowned as winner at the end of the event.

Special awards
Award | Name | Country |
---|---|---|
Miss Photogenic | Aarti Chabaria | ![]() |
Miss Congeniality | Gaby Janita Arjun Sharma | ![]() |
Best Talent | Anupama Anand | ![]() |
Most Beautiful Face | Aarti Chabaria | ![]() |
Miss Beautiful Hair | Heera Ragubir | ![]() |
Most Beautiful Smile | Kavita Malhotra | ![]() |
Most Beautiful Skin | Simran Kochar | ![]() |
Delegates
Barbados – Natalie Awad
Belgium – Neela Premlata Renu Ramdas
Canada – Komila “Kim” Jagtiani
Grenada – Kavita Malhotra
Guyana – Heera Ragubir
Hong Kong – Anupama Anand
India – Aarti Chabaria
Jamaica – Sunita A. Ramlal
Mauritius – Géraldine Heeroo
Netherlands – Gaby Janita Arjun Sharma
Reunion – Sabrina Swamy
Singapore – Sri Rajini Sathyamurthi
Sint Maarten – Denisia Sookram
Sri Lanka – Brenda Menaka Poorajan
South Africa – Maashi Ramdutt
Suriname – Maya Sudama
Switzerland – Shalini Sanghvi
Trinidad – Kavita Jagmohan
Tobago – Elizabeth Alicia John
United Kingdom – Simran Kochar
United States – Sharan Gill
United Arab Emirates – Keralite Shweta Vijay
